Lakshmi Shankar was a distinguished Indian classical vocalist known for her contributions to Hindustani music. Born in 1926, she was a disciple of the legendary sitar maestro Pandit Ravi Shankar and gained international recognition for her performances. Her unique voice and emotive singing style earned her a place among the greats of Indian classical music, and she played a vital role in popularizing Indian music across the globe.
